Took the 67 convertible out for a short drive before it rained yesterday. 
When I first fired it up I tried to get it out of the garage before it stunk 
up the place with exhaust fumes. It was not warmed up but it left a six foot 
or so trail of tranny fluid out of the garage then quit. I let it sit 
running in neautral to warm up. No more leaking anywhere. I checked it after 
my run and all was normal. Any guesses as to why it peed a small amount?
